首页 百科 正文

大数据技术到底是干啥的

标题:探索大数据技术的具体工作内容大数据技术是指用于处理和分析海量数据的一系列技术和工具。随着数据规模的不断增长,大数据技术在各行业中扮演着越来越重要的角色。下面我们来详细了解一下大数据技术的具体工作...

探索大数据技术的具体工作内容

大数据技术是指用于处理和分析海量数据的一系列技术和工具。随着数据规模的不断增长,大数据技术在各行业中扮演着越来越重要的角色。下面我们来详细了解一下大数据技术的具体工作内容。

1. 数据采集与清洗

大数据技术的第一步是数据采集。这包括从各种来源(如传感器、网站、社交媒体等)收集数据,并将其存储在合适的数据存储系统中。在这个阶段,数据工程师负责设计和实施数据采集系统,确保数据能够按时、按需、高效地被获取。

清洗数据也是至关重要的一步,因为原始数据往往会包含大量的噪音、重复和不一致的信息。数据工程师需要编写程序或使用工具来清洗数据,确保数据的质量和一致性,以便后续的分析和挖掘。

2. 数据存储与管理

大数据技术涉及处理海量的数据,因此高效的数据存储和管理至关重要。数据工程师需要选择合适的数据存储系统,如关系型数据库、NoSQL数据库、数据湖等,并设计相应的数据管理策略,确保数据的安全性、可靠性和可扩展性。

3. 数据处理与分析

一旦数据被采集和存储,接下来就是对数据进行处理和分析。这包括数据的预处理、特征提取、模式识别、数据挖掘等过程。数据工程师和数据科学家通常会使用各种数据处理和分析工具,如Hadoop、Spark、Python等,来处理和分析数据,并从中提取出有价值的信息和见解。

4. 数据可视化与报告

将数据转化为可视化的图表、报告和仪表盘是大数据技术的重要应用之一。数据可视化能够帮助人们更直观地理解数据,并从中发现隐藏的模式和趋势。数据工程师和数据分析师通常会使用各种数据可视化工具,如Tableau、Power BI等,来创建各种交互式的数据可视化产品,以支持业务决策和战略规划。

5. 数据安全与隐私保护

随着数据泄露和隐私问题的日益严重,数据安全和隐私保护成为大数据技术中的重要议题。数据工程师需要设计和实施安全的数据存储和传输机制,以保护数据的机密性、完整性和可用性,并遵守相关的法律法规和行业标准,如GDPR、HIPAA等。

6. 实时数据处理与流式计算

随着数据产生速度的不断加快,实时数据处理和流式计算变得越来越重要。数据工程师需要设计和实施实时数据处理系统,以实时地处理和分析数据,并及时做出响应。这包括使用流式处理框架如Apache Kafka、Flink等,以及设计实时数据处理算法和模型。

7. 数据治理与质量管理

数据治理和质量管理是保证数据有效使用和价值最大化的关键环节。数据工程师需要制定数据治理政策和流程,确保数据的合规性、一致性和可信度,并建立数据质量管理系统,监控和改进数据质量。

结语

大数据技术涵盖了数据采集、存储、处理、分析、可视化等多个方面,需要数据工程师、数据科学家、数据分析师等多个职业的协作。通过合理的数据处理和分析,可以挖掘出数据中隐藏的价值和见解,为企业决策和创新提供有力支持。